Бакалавр в області комп'ютерних наук
University Of Wisconsin - Green Bay
Ключова інформація
Розташування кампусу
Green Bay, США
Лінгвістика
Англійська
Формат навчання
На кампусі
Тривалість
інформація
Форма навчання
Денне навчання, Заочне навчання
Вартість навчання
інформація
Кінець терміну надання заяв
інформація
Найраніша дата початку
Sep 2023
Стипендії
Вивчіть можливості отримання стипендій, щоб допомогти фінансувати своє навчання
Введення
The інформатика програма про рішення проблем і можливість вивчити нові ідеї і застосовувати їх. Це тому, що серце дизайну програмного забезпечення не є мовою або середовище розробника, але здатність визначити проблему, проаналізувати різні компоненти, а також проектів і оцінки потенційних рішень, всі з яких з урахуванням обмежень і обмежень, властивих даному комп'ютера.
Студенти повинні розуміти, що в промисловості повинна бути більше, ніж просто робочої програми. Гарне програмне забезпечення має не тільки працювати, але повинні бути повністю задокументовані, чітко написано, і легко змінюваний для задоволення мінливих і більш широкі вимоги.
Огляд
Галузі інформатики переживає великі зміни у міру розвитку технологій і необхідність комп'ютерного програмного забезпечення зростає. Студенти, які надходять Це поле не повинно бачити ступінь бакалавра в галузі комп'ютерних наук в якості кульмінації дослідження в цій області. Швидше за все, вони повинні бачити його в якості першого кроку в безперервний процес освіти, який триватиме до тих пір, як вони вирішили залишитися в цій галузі. Мета Computer Science мажор полягає в наданні студентам міцну основу, на якій вони можуть продовжувати будувати при зміні поля. Студенти можуть отримати інструкції в таких областях, як розробка програмного забезпечення та управління проектами, об'єктно-орієнтованого програмування, проектування алгоритмів, операційні системи, системи управління базами даних, нейронні мережі, комп'ютерної графіки, мережевого програмування, і багато іншого.
Комп'ютерні науки курси часто помилково приймають за курси програмування. Насправді, вони вимагають набагато більше, ніж навчання та освоєння мови програмування. Серце розробки програмного забезпечення не є мовою, але здатність визначати проблему, проаналізувати різні компоненти, а проект і оцінити можливі рішення, які всі повинні бути масштабованими та надійними. Це також повинно бути зроблено відповідно до того обмеженням, що вони підлягають обмеженням і обмежень, властивих в тій чи іншій комп'ютер. Студенти повинні розуміти, що в промисловості повинна бути більше, ніж просто робочої програми. Гарне програмне забезпечення повинне не тільки працювати, але повинні бути повністю документовані, чітко написано, легко змінюваний відповідно до змінних і більш великі вимоги і розроблено для стабільності, безпеки і правильності.
Не менш важливо, програма передбачає теоретичну базу для інформатики та допомагає студентам зрозуміти це ще інформатики, ніж розробка програмного забезпечення. Студенти розвивають навички, які вони можуть використовувати після закінчення але вони повинні бути готові ввести поле, яке є одночасно різноманітні і швидко змінюється, і вони повинні бути в змозі адаптуватися до нових технологій. Це вимагає міцну теоретичну основу зі знанням про те, як працюють комп'ютери і як вони виконують завдання, зазначені в додатках програмного забезпечення. Він вимагає, щоб студенти думають за написання програмного забезпечення і досліджувати такі області, як нейронні мережі, комп'ютерної графіки, аналізу алгоритму, або наукових додатків. Це знання є важливим компонентом професійного розвитку, оскільки це дає їм інструменти, необхідні для аналізу ефективності та оцінки різних варіантів програм і проектних даних і бачити можливі варіанти майбутнього, як інформатика розвивається. Просто надаючи їм навички, необхідні, щоб увійти в обчислювальну професії не є достатнім. Кожен студент повинен бути готовий застосувати те, що він або вона дізналася того, щоб адаптуватися до неминучих змін, які стануться. Кожен повинен також мати можливість вивчити нові ідеї і застосовувати їх.
Випускники програми Комп'ютерні науки готуються продовжити свою освіту в аспірантурі або подати заяву на позиції початкового рівня в промисловості. Типові робочі місця початкового рівня програміст або програміст / аналітик позиції.
Студенти спеціальності в галузі комп'ютерних наук є два варіанти. Перший дисциплінарної доріжки і призначений для тих, хто зацікавлений у проведенні кар'єру в таких областях, як розробка програмного забезпечення відразу ж після закінчення школи. Він має акцент на основних темах інформатики тому числі і фундаментальні теорії і програмного забезпечення. Студенти, які вибирають цей трек також повинні вибрати неповнолітнього зі списку міждисциплінарних неповнолітніх, пропонованих університетом. Найбільш поширені варіанти інформаційних наук і ділового адміністрування, але є й інші варіанти. Другий напрямок полягає міждисциплінарний трек об'єднання інформатики та математики курси. Він призначений, щоб допомогти студентам зрозуміти деякі з більш складних принципів, які складають основу такі теми, як аналіз алгоритмів, систем числення, кодування, формальний мову, і шифрування. Хоча він також служить студентів, які кар'єри пов'язані після закінчення школи, ті студенти, зацікавлені в проведенні аспірантуру в області комп'ютерної науки, настійно рекомендується, щоб вибрати цей трек. Студенти, що навчаються цей трек не потрібно вибрати Міждисциплінарний.
Всі зареєстровані студенти мають доступ до обчислювальної техніки Університету. Студент рахунку дозволяють студентам отримати доступ до різноманітних обох ПК-сумісних і Macintosh комп'ютерів, серверів Linux і бази даних (вибирати курси), різні середовища розробник програмного забезпечення, і, звичайно, інтернет. Крім того, через участь департаменту в Microsoft Academic Alliance, зарахованих в галузі комп'ютерних наук курси також мають право прав для домашнього використання для різних продуктів Microsoft. Labs відкриті сім днів на тиждень і працюють консультанти, які надають допомогу у використанні об'єктів. Класні кімнати також мережеві з'єднання, які дозволяють демонстрації програмного забезпечення та інтернет-додатків, які будуть інтегровані з аудиторні лекції. Існує також викладання інформатики лабораторія з 28 робочих станцій і засобів відображення, які підтримують команду Computer Science.
Комп'ютерна наука програми навчання мають строгу структуру попередніх умов. Вкрай важливо, що студенти вчаться, які курси є передумовами для інших, і коли вони пропонуються. Студенти настійно рекомендується, щоб поговорити з консультантом на самому початку їх навчання в коледжі.
Студенти з метою отримання інформації про сертифікацію вчителів слід звернутися до Управління освіти.
Результати навчання
- Студенти повинні вміти проектувати логічні та інформаційні структури, необхідні для створення програмного забезпечення, здатного вирішувати проблеми, що підлягають заданим обмеженням.
- Студенти повинні розвивати як письмові та усні навички спілкування, які підтримують розробку та документування програмних продуктів і допомоги утиліт.
- Студенти повинні вміти аналізувати програмне забезпечення для визначення правильності і, якщо невірно, бути в змозі визначити причину помилки і виправити їх.
- Студенти повинні розуміти основоположні принципи і теорії як комп'ютерного обладнання та програмного забезпечення і математичних основ, на яких будується Computer Science.
English Language Requirements
Підтвердьте свій рівень володіння англійською мовою за допомогою Duolingo English Test! DET — це зручний, швидкий і доступний онлайн-тест з англійської мови, прийнятий понад 4000 університетами (як цей) у всьому світі.
Про Школу
Запитання
Подібні курси
Бакалавр комп'ютерної техніки
- Istanbul, Туреччина
Бакалавр інформатики
- Lewiston, США
Бакалавр наук у галузі програмної інженерії
- Nashville, США